Briefing: Inventory Write-Down — Solenne Hardware

For the finance team. We propose writing down obsolete Solenne V2 controller stock held at the Bramfield warehouse, reflecting the V3 transition. Estimated impact is contained within current reserves. Audit documentation is prepared and reviewed by Tomas Reale. Approval is requested before quarter close. The confidential planning note appears below.

internal memo for hahaf-kahof: Only 39 of the 428 pilot accounts renewed Sorion, so a churn review is set for April 12. Praokix Freight is in early talks to buy Queniusox Group for about $145.8 million.

// Heads up for release cut: this client talks to the Meadowlark
// calendar bridge, which still double-books when the Quill sync
// agent and our own writer race on the same slot. The retry
// wrapper below papers over the conflict until the dedupe fix
// ships in 3.9. Don't bump the timeout — it masks real failures.
// The bridge authenticates with the internal service key below.

app token of kajop-tahag = qvz23-qaEp6MzrfP2AwhVbZwsZeUq

== Budget Request: Project Tillowmere (Managers Only) ==

This page summarises the funding request for the incoming director's review. The Tillowmere team seeks a 14% uplift to cover tooling upgrades, two contractor extensions, and compliance testing at the Gravenholt lab. Prior-year underspend partially offsets the ask. Finance has validated the figures. The rationale connecting this request to wider plans appears directly below.

board note of kageg-bahof: The renewal with Holwynax Holdings closes at $2 million a year, 5 percent below the last contract. Project Ulaath slips by two quarters because of the supplier delay.

## Onboarding: Formula Sandbox Review Notes

When reviewing changes to Quillgrid's formula engine, remember that all user-supplied expressions execute inside the Hollowbox sandbox, never in the host process. The sandbox worker is a separate binary with no filesystem or network access, and it authenticates back to the coordinator using a shared secret loaded from the environment at spawn time. Reviewers should verify that no code path logs or serializes this value. In local setups, the sandbox `.env` must contain the following line.

vault entry, kafog-yahop: COURIER_KEY8=0faa53ae